Pesquisar este blog

Mostrando postagens com marcador geração de código. Mostrar todas as postagens
Mostrando postagens com marcador geração de código. Mostrar todas as postagens

Como o ChatGPT Pode Transformar a Programação

A programação é uma disciplina em constante evolução, e a integração de tecnologias de inteligência artificial, como o ChatGPT, está mudando a maneira como os desenvolvedores abordam seus projetos. Aqui estão algumas maneiras de como o ChatGPT pode transformar o cenário da programação.

1. Assistência na Resolução de Problemas

O ChatGPT pode ajudar programadores a solucionar problemas rapidamente. Ao descrever um erro ou uma dificuldade, os desenvolvedores podem receber sugestões de solução, dicas de depuração ou até mesmo exemplos de código, economizando tempo e esforço na busca por respostas.

2. Geração de Código

Uma das características mais impressionantes do ChatGPT é sua capacidade de gerar código com base em descrições de funcionalidades. Isso pode acelerar o desenvolvimento, permitindo que os programadores se concentrem mais na lógica e na arquitetura do projeto, enquanto o ChatGPT cuida das implementações mais repetitivas.

3. Documentação e Comentários

A documentação é um aspecto muitas vezes negligenciado no desenvolvimento de software. O ChatGPT pode ajudar a gerar documentação clara e concisa, além de sugerir comentários explicativos para o código, facilitando a manutenção e a compreensão por parte de outros desenvolvedores.

4. Educação e Aprendizado

Para aqueles que estão começando na programação, o ChatGPT pode ser uma ferramenta valiosa para o aprendizado. Ele pode explicar conceitos, responder a perguntas sobre sintaxe, estruturas de dados e algoritmos, além de sugerir exercícios práticos para reforçar o aprendizado.

5. Prototipagem Rápida

Com a capacidade de gerar rapidamente trechos de código, o ChatGPT pode facilitar a prototipagem de ideias. Desenvolvedores podem experimentar diferentes abordagens e testar rapidamente suas hipóteses, acelerando o processo de inovação.

6. Integração com Ferramentas de Desenvolvimento

O ChatGPT pode ser integrado a ambientes de desenvolvimento, como IDEs e editores de texto. Isso proporciona uma experiência de codificação mais interativa, onde os desenvolvedores podem solicitar ajuda ou sugestões diretamente enquanto trabalham em seus projetos.

7. Apoio em Revisões de Código

O ChatGPT pode auxiliar em revisões de código, oferecendo feedback sobre boas práticas, estilo de codificação e potenciais melhorias. Isso pode ajudar a manter a qualidade do código e a promover um desenvolvimento mais colaborativo.

8. Customização e Personalização

À medida que os desenvolvedores se tornam mais familiarizados com o ChatGPT, eles podem personalizar as interações, ajustando o tom e o nível de detalhe nas respostas. Isso permite uma assistência mais alinhada às necessidades individuais de cada programador.

O ChatGPT tem o potencial de transformar a maneira como programadores trabalham, aprendem e colaboram. Ao oferecer suporte em diversas áreas do desenvolvimento de software, desde a resolução de problemas até a documentação, essa tecnologia pode não apenas aumentar a eficiência, mas também tornar a programação mais acessível e agradável. À medida que a inteligência artificial continua a evoluir, o papel do ChatGPT como assistente virtual se tornará cada vez mais relevante na jornada dos desenvolvedores.

A Tecnologia NFC: Facilitando Conexões Rápidas e Seguras

O NFC (Near Field Communication) é uma tecnologia inovadora que está transformando a maneira como nos conectamos com o mundo ao nosso redor....